Consultation to remove Direct Glasgow and Stirling services

From December 2024 LNER will withdraw its Glasgow and Stirling extensions.

Glasgow Central and Stirling proposals

London North Eastern Railway (LNER) ran an 8-week consultation from 22 January 2024 to 18 March 2024 on proposals to remove its Glasgow and Stirling extensions. 

The responses to LNER’s consultation on proposals to remove Glasgow and Stirling extensions demonstrated the importance that rail has to many.  

However, after careful consideration of the consultation responses, LNER has decided that it will proceed with proposals to remove the Glasgow and Stirling extensions from the December 2024 timetable.  

LNER recognises the importance of rail services for passengers, and that the planned reduction from December 2024 may raise concerns for people affected.

Impacted Stations 

Proposed changes to our timetable* 

Stirling (and Falkirk Grahamston) 

Southbound 

Remove 05.34 Stirling service  

Remove 05.47 Falkirk Grahamston service 

Northbound 

Remove 20.12 Stirling service  

Remove 19.58 Falkirk Grahamston service 

Glasgow Central (and Motherwell) 

Southbound 

Remove 06.48 Glasgow Central service  

Remove 07.04 Motherwell service  

Northbound 

Remove 21.03 Motherwell service 

Remove 21.26 Glasgow Central service 

*Timings as in December 2023 timetable. 

These changes mean that LNER will no longer stop at Haymarket (Edinburgh) and 06.14 and 07.48 southbound and 19.33 and 20.24 northbound (as in December 2023 timetable)
